The second season of hit Korean series Squid Game, Squid Game: The Challenge, is set to premiere in November, the streaming platform announced.

The second season will consist of 10 episodes and was shot in the United Kingdom.  

Squid Game is set in a dystopian economic environment of Korea where game participants are picked to compete against each other in different levels that are designed using simple Korean street games. It had become the first ever non-English series to be nominated for Outstanding Drama Series at the Emmy's 2022.

Lee had earlier revealed that the core plot of the second season will be revenge and key figures that controlled the working of the games. The actor also added that he will be working with Lee Byung-hun who portrayed The Front Man.
